Transaction f8366df6b4854984211c46fddbcd6c32d16f6a08b0345d8e9727e68c2dab534a

50 Input
1 Outputs
  • f8366df6b4854984211c46fddbcd6c32d16f6a08b0345d8e9727e68c2dab534a:0
  • value  795785567
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P